Band filters: two-material technology versus rugate

Not Accessible

Your library or personal account may give you access

Abstract

We demonstrate theoretically and experimentally a band filter with two reflection and broadband transmission ranges, which was obtained with standard two-material technology. The fabricated filter has transmission and reflectivity characteristics better than those achievable with rugate technology.
